The Superoxide Dismutase Activity of Binuclear Model Compounds Containing Copper (Ⅱ), Iron(Ⅲ) and Manganese (Ⅱ)

Abstract: We synthesized and characterized a ligand, N,N,N',N'-tetrakis (2'-benzimidazolyl methyl)-1,4-diethylene amino glycol ether (EGTB) and its binuclear complexes containing cop-per(Ⅱ), iron(Ⅲ) and manganese(Ⅱ).An assay of superoxide dismutase (SOD) activity was performed by means of pyrogallol autoxidation.It was found that all model compounds possess excellent SODactivity and they show more than 50% inhibition ratio in the concentration range of 10-6~10-7 mol/L of the complexes.
